				<!-- videoId: explore/io9/videos/2288 --><!-- /videoId: explore/io9/videos/2288 --> The Hoff, wearing buckets of makeup, <a href="http://www.badmovies.org/movies/starcrash/">fences with</a> killer bots in <em>Star Crash</em>. The worst of the late 70s <em>Star Wars</em> knockoffs, <em>Crash</em> features lots of Harryhausen-style stop motion animation alongside widescreen space battles. Caroline Munroe has really shiny hair and low-cut tops. But my favorite character is the <a href="http://sacrificepawn.blogspot.com/2005/10/review-star-crash-1979.html">Southern</a>-accented android (Hamilton Camp), who looks like Darth Vader but is named Elle and wears a rainbow flag on the back of his belt.
